    Soya milk powder you can get from Veganstore and also useful for making vegan Barfi (indian sweet). Don't bother with white flora, just use extra pure.
    I always used to make butter cream icing with a little fat rubbed into icing sugar then a little cold water(plus cocoa or whatever). I found the all fat version in this book MUCH too rich. Also don't make anything like the quantity they suggest - as others have mentioned her.

    look online at specialty gourmet suppliers for the best price. The quantities are small; so is the postage.

    I use apple juice concentrate, thawed, instead of cider

    applebutter can be used up in a pie or just added to stewed fruit

    Whole spices keep forever if airtight cool and dark (suck air out of ziplock bag to vacuum pack it)

    Heaps of recipes to use up agar... mousse anyone? It does go stale exposed to moisture in the air so store well

    Grind up your own green tea and sift thru a tea strainer
